Georg Lasius

from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Georg Lasius (born April 15, 1835 in Easter Castle , † June 28, 1928 in Zurich ; full name: Georg Christian Otto Lasius ) was a German architect and university professor .

Life

Lasius was a son of the architect Otto Lasius (1797–1888). He initially served as a seaman from 1851 to 1853. From 1854 to 1857 he studied architecture at the Hanover Polytechnic , where he also worked practically with Conrad Wilhelm Hase . During his studies in Hanover, Lasius became a member of the Corps Saxonia there . In 1859 he continued his studies with Gottfried Semper at the Zurich Polytechnic . After passing the state examination (1860) and working in Oldenburg, he completed his habilitation in 1862 at the Zurich Polytechnic. He then stayed temporarily in Paris. In 1863 he returned to Zurich, where in 1867 he became professor of building construction theory and architectural drawing. In 1923 he retired.

Among his children were the painter and graphic artist Otto Lasius (1866–1933), the architect Theodor Lasius (* 1868) and the painter Wilhelm Lasius (* 1871).

Awards

The University of Zurich awarded Lasius an honorary doctorate in 1905 .

Works (selection)

Buildings and designs

  • 1884: Institute for Chemistry at the Zurich Polytechnic (together with Alfred Friedrich Bluntschli )
  • 1885: Atelier for Arnold Böcklin in Zurich
  • 1886–1890: Institute for Physics at the Zurich Polytechnic (together with Alfred Friedrich Bluntschli)
